What is OCD?
Obsessive-Compulsive Disorder (OCD) is a mental health condition distinguished by persistent, intrusive thoughts (obsessions) and repetitive actions (compulsions) that an individual feels driven to engage in. These obsessions and compulsions can markedly disrupt daily routines and cause distress.
Common obsessions are fears of contamination or losing control, while compulsions might involve excessive cleaning or arranging. At Nuview, we specialize in providing comprehensive, cost-effective OCD treatment in San Francisco.

Individual Therapy for the Treatment of OCD
Individual therapy or therapy provided in a one-on-one setting is most effective with OCD. Usually, this involves Cognitive-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and Exposure and Response Prevention (ERP), the most effective treatment options for OCD and anxiety-related disorders.
NuView’s experienced team in San Francisco works one-on-one with clients to develop comprehensive treatment plans. CBT helps clients develop tools to significantly reduce the severity and frequency of OCD symptoms, improving overall quality of life. ERP involves exposing individuals to their fears or obsessions in a controlled environment and helping them resist the urge to engage in compulsive behaviors.

Exposure and Response Prevention (ERP) is a highly effective component of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) for treating Obsessive-Compulsive Disorder (OCD). ERP involves exposing individuals to their fears or obsessions in a controlled environment and helping them resist the urge to engage in compulsive behaviors.
By gradually facing their fears without performing compulsions, individuals can reduce anxiety and learn that their feared outcomes are unlikely. How Do I Know If I Or A Loved One Needs Professional Help For OCD?
Recognizing the need for professional help for OCD can be challenging, but certain signs indicate it may be necessary. If obsessive thoughts and compulsive behaviors cause significant anxiety, or if you engage in repetitive behaviors that interfere with daily life, it may be time to seek professional help.
Additional signs include dedicating excessive time to compulsive behaviors, avoiding situations that provoke obsessions, and facing distress or difficulties in social, work, or other crucial aspects of life.

What is OCD, and how is it treated?
OCD is a mental health condition, which is characterized by persistent, repetitive compulsions and behaviors. OCD is effectively treated with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and Exposure and Response Prevention (ERP).
What are the symptoms of OCD?
Symptoms of OCD include persistent, unwanted thoughts (obsessions) and repetitive behaviors (compulsions) performed to reduce anxiety. Common obsessions include the fears of contamination, doubts, and intrusive thoughts, while compulsions often involve cleaning, checking, and repeating actions.
What are the causes of OCD?
The exact causes of OCD are unknown, but factors may include genetics, brain structure and function, and environmental influences. Research suggests a combination of these factors contributes to the development of OCD.

How long does OCD treatment typically last?
The duration of OCD treatment varies but generally ranges from a few months to a year, depending on the severity of symptoms and individual progress. Regular CBT and ERP sessions are crucial for successful outcomes.
What happens if OCD is not treated?
If left untreated, OCD can worsen over time, leading to significant distress and impairment in daily functioning. Untreated OCD can interfere with work, relationships, and overall well-being.
